powered by simpleCommunicator - 2.0.55     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Форма
25 сообщений из 48, страница 1 из 2
Форма
    #39164405
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ем привет, никак не могу найти решение следующих проблем. На форме есть поля из таблицы №1 которая содержит следующие столбцы: Город, улица, дом. На форме все поля добавлены, поле город-поле со списком, как сделать так чтобы при выборе в том списке, поля улица и дом заполнялись автоматически из таблицы? И еще как сделать, так чтобы вносимые в форму данные сегодня попадали сначала во временную таблицу из которой будет формироваться отчет по введенным данным, а лишь затем попадали в общую накопительную таблицу?
...
Рейтинг: 0 / 0
Форма
    #39164429
Фотография Лапух
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Может вот такой примерчик поможет?
...
Рейтинг: 0 / 0
Форма
    #39164721
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Честно говоря не смог разобраться в данном примере. Передо мной стоит такая задача.
Еженедельно мне в бумажном виде приходят акты выполненных работ об обслуженной техники в офисах заказчика (акт содержит номер офиса заказчика, город расположения, адрес, наименование оборудования, серийный, инвентарный номер и дата работ).
Мне необходимо эту информацию собирать в кучу и формировать отчет на текущую дату. Есть уже сформированная база в екселе, ее думал перенести в аксесс. Задача - беру в руки акт в поиске ввожу серийник или номер офиса и вижу единицу оборудования, щелк и запись добавляется, причем чтобы при добавлении выдавался запрос на ввод даты проведенных работ по этому оборудованию. Для того чтобы потом не запутаться в датах, как сделать так, чтобы текущий отчет сохранялся в виде таблицы с текущей датой?! Помогите, кто может.
...
Рейтинг: 0 / 0
Форма
    #39164779
Predeclared
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Как-то так, не?
...
Рейтинг: 0 / 0
Форма
    #39164817
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Очень похоже на какой то учебный материал, по мойму не...
...
Рейтинг: 0 / 0
Форма
    #39164870
Фотография ПЕНСИОНЕРКА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ЁклмнВсем привет, никак не могу найти решение следующих проблем. На форме есть поля из таблицы №1 которая содержит следующие столбцы: Город, улица, дом. На форме все поля добавлены, поле город-поле со списком, как сделать так чтобы при выборе в том списке, поля улица и дом заполнялись автоматически из таблицы? И еще как сделать, так чтобы вносимые в форму данные сегодня попадали сначала во временную таблицу из которой будет формироваться отчет по введенным данным, а лишь затем попадали в общую накопительную таблицу?
№ офисаГородАдресДомНаименованиесерийный номеринвентарный номердатаТехникВид работЦена1г.Ижевскул.Тельмана30Cannon03020985RO3907503.02.2016Иванов И.И.Ремонт1502г.Ижевскул.Тельмана30Cannon03020986RO3907603.02.2016Иванов И.И.ТО1503г.Ижевскул.Тельмана30Cannon03020987RO3907703.02.2016Иванов И.И.ТО1504г.Ижевскул.Тельмана30Cannon03020988RO3907803.02.2016Иванов И.И.ТО150....9г.Ижевскул.Тельмана30Cannon03020993RO3908301.02.2016Иванов И.И.Ремонт15010г.Ижевскул.Тельмана30Cannon03020994RO3908401.02.2016Иванов И.И.Ремонт15011г.Ижевскул.Тельмана30Cannon03020995RO3908501.02.2016Иванов И.И.Ремонт15012г.Ижевскул.Тельмана30Cannon03020996RO3908601.02.2016Иванов И.И.Ремонт150

это все , что вы выложили
но что-бы присоединять город/улицу/наименования\сотрудник....
надо создать таблицы -справочники и создать форму для выбора из них
...
Рейтинг: 0 / 0
Форма
    #39164962
Фотография Лапух
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н...Мне необходимо эту информацию собирать в кучу и формировать отчет ...
Что бы сформировать отчет, для начала нужно ввести данные.
В моем примере легко и удобно вводить адреса.
Сначала в форме вводите - Страну, затем - Ренион, Район, Населенный пункт и т. п.
Если к вас будет всего 20-30 адресов, то конечно такие сложности не нужны, а вот если сотни или тысячи разных адресов, то без этого не обойтись, т. к. найти или отфильтровать так быдет намного легче и главное без ощибок.
...
Рейтинг: 0 / 0
Форма
    #39164973
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нет, городов немного, правильно указали всего 20-30 не более и выбор страны излишен. Вот у меня есть еще пример, его пробую доработать. В форме f2 выделяю нужное мне оборудование и как его (ту строку) полностью скопировать в новую таблицу, но с возможностью выбора или внесения даты, и по возможности эту временную таблицу именовать бы системной датой на момент ее создания...
...
Рейтинг: 0 / 0
Форма
    #39164979
Фотография Лапух
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Не совсем понятна задумка.
Если немного и понял, то по идее наверное нужна подчиненная форма табличного вида, где в поле со списком можно выбрать адрес и в других полях указывать уже свои нужные значения.
В элементе - Список, это сделать нельзя, только просмотреть или же указав на нужную запись найти ее и уже дальше НЕ В СПИСКЕ менять данные в других элементах формы связаных например скодом именно этой записи.
...
Рейтинг: 0 / 0
Форма
    #39165003
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ЛапухНе совсем понятна задумка.
Если немного и понял, то по идее наверное нужна подчиненная форма табличного вида, где в поле со списком можно выбрать адрес и в других полях указывать уже свои нужные значения.
В элементе - Список, это сделать нельзя, только просмотреть или же указав на нужную запись найти ее и уже дальше НЕ В СПИСКЕ менять данные в других элементах формы связаных например скодом именно этой записи. Скорее не менять, а добавлять ее в новую таблицу с добавлением столбца-дата. Как то сделать подскажете?
...
Рейтинг: 0 / 0
Форма
    #39165017
Фотография ПЕНСИОНЕРКА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н,

нечто подобное
...
Рейтинг: 0 / 0
Форма
    #39165019
Фотография Лапух
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н...Как то сделать подскажете?...
Если же опять правильно понял, то вот так.
Типа у каждой новой записи в поле со списком Номер выбираете нужный адрес, вставляется только номер, а сам адрес просто отображается, а не вставляется в другую таблицу, это не нужно и утяжеляет вес базы.
В элементе - Список при нажатии на нужную запись по процедуре - После обновления - сразу переходите на нее и уже можете редактировать другие значения в других полях.
...
Рейтинг: 0 / 0
Форма
    #39165040
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Гм....В таблице работа уже есть полный перечень оборудования с номером офиса заказчика и серийным номером, их там как раз править не нужно, из нее мне их нужно выдергивать и вставлять во вновь создаваемую таблицу (т.е. которая создаться при первом добавлении записи в нее) с добавлением столбца-дата. Т.е. в итоге нужно получить таблицу со следующими столбцами:
Номер Оборудование серийный номер дата
...
Рейтинг: 0 / 0
Форма
    #39165043
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Т.е. как я думал реализовать. В форме f2 есть список-s1, в котором отображается результат поиска по нужному критерию, щелкаем по любой записи в том списке и данная запись добавляется во второй список, который расположен ниже списка s1. Причем можно ли реализовать это таким образом чтобы после того как щелкнуть по записи и перед ее добавлением в список ниже всплывало менюшка с просьбой ввести дату. Т.е. в списке s2 следующие столбцы: Оборудование серийный номер номер адрес дата. И при добавлении первой же записи в этот список s2 сразу формируется новая таблица, куда все эти понащелканные записи складываются, т.е. в списке s2 они просто отображаются, а на самом деле создается новая таблица.
Вот блин замутил, но вот так требует начальство, помогите если можете...
...
Рейтинг: 0 / 0
Форма
    #39165050
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Кстати в таблице - Адреса, поле номер уникально, тогда как в таблице Работа оно может и будет повторяться, там уникальных записей нет ни в одно из ячеек.
...
Рейтинг: 0 / 0
Форма
    #39165056
Фотография ПЕНСИОНЕРКА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н,

в своем примере я это сделала
посмотрите клиента 1
...
Рейтинг: 0 / 0
Форма
    #39165060
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ПЕНСИОНЕРКАЁклмн,

в своем примере я это сделала
посмотрите клиента 1
Записи не нужно править в таблице - Работа, их нужно выдергивать оттуда и вставлять в другу таблицу с подстановкой даты в виде всплывающего меню-запроса.
...
Рейтинг: 0 / 0
Форма
    #39165061
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ПЕНСИОНЕРКАЁклмн,

в своем примере я это сделала
посмотрите клиента 1
Кстати, почему то открывается с ошибкой, пишет - содержаться элементы или свойства не распознаваемые аксессом, будут отключены....
...
Рейтинг: 0 / 0
Форма
    #39165063
Predeclared
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н..., их нужно выдергивать оттуда и вставлять в другу таблицу с подстановкой даты в виде всплывающего меню-запроса.
:)

Вы завтра, с утреца, возьмите в кассе денег под отчет и бегом в ближайший книжный магазин
за учебниками по Access из серии "для чайников".

После внимательного изучения и осознания разницы между Excel и Access,
возвращайтесь к построению своей бд на Access,
либо оставайтесь с Excel, и забудьте про Access.
...
Рейтинг: 0 / 0
Форма
    #39165065
Фотография ПЕНСИОНЕРКА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н,

если работа --это справочник работ, то нужна еще таблица связи (адреса-работы )
повторно выкладываю базу
...
Рейтинг: 0 / 0
Форма
    #39165067
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
PredeclaredЁклмн..., их нужно выдергивать оттуда и вставлять в другу таблицу с подстановкой даты в виде всплывающего меню-запроса.
:)

Вы завтра, с утреца, возьмите в кассе денег под отчет и бегом в ближайший книжный магазин
за учебниками по Access из серии "для чайников".

После внимательного изучения и осознания разницы между Excel и Access,
возвращайтесь к построению своей бд на Access,
либо оставайтесь с Excel, и забудьте про Access.
В аксессе невозможно по двойному щелчку запись переносить в запрос на создание таблицы?
...
Рейтинг: 0 / 0
Форма
    #39165076
Predeclared
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мн... В аксессе невозможно по двойному щелчку запись переносить в запрос на создание таблицы?
В Access возможно многое, в том числе и это.
"В нем" даже можно слушать музыку и рисовать, например.

Вот только он предназначен совершенно для других целей,
а слушать музыку и рисовать значительно удобнее в специально заточенных для этого приложениях.
...
Рейтинг: 0 / 0
Форма
    #39165099
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
PredeclaredЁклмн... В аксессе невозможно по двойному щелчку запись переносить в запрос на создание таблицы?
В Access возможно многое, в том числе и это.
"В нем" даже можно слушать музыку и рисовать, например.

Вот только он предназначен совершенно для других целей,
а слушать музыку и рисовать значительно удобнее в специально заточенных для этого приложениях.
Да не нужно мне музыку слушать или рисовать, мне просто нужно по двойному щелчку добавлять запись с введением даты во вновь создаваемую таблицу!!!
...
Рейтинг: 0 / 0
Форма
    #39165106
Фотография ПЕНСИОНЕРКА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ёклмнво вновь создаваемую таблицу!!!
или в существующую

--открыли (клиента--список)
--выбрали клиента и открыли (клиент-одиночную форму)
--открыли (справочник товаров/услуг.,,,,)
--при клике на строке справочника занести выбранную строку в таблицу (клиентТабличная часть) с добавлением даты и сотрудника, который проводил отбор(сообщается где-то в заголовке формы)
...
Рейтинг: 0 / 0
Форма
    #39165202
Ёклмн
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ПЕНСИОНЕРКАЁклмнво вновь создаваемую таблицу!!!
или в существующую

--открыли (клиента--список)
--выбрали клиента и открыли (клиент-одиночную форму)
--открыли (справочник товаров/услуг.,,,,)
--при клике на строке справочника занести выбранную строку в таблицу (клиентТабличная часть) с добавлением даты и сотрудника, который проводил отбор(сообщается где-то в заголовке формы)
Почему я говорю про новую таблицу - потому что из нее из новой таблицу я буду далее формировать отчет-накладную. А лишь потом из данной новой таблицы буду с помощью запроса на обновление вливать данные в существующую-Работа, которая и будет являтся как раз таки накопительной. А если сразу данные добавлять в существующую-Работа, как потом я отберу новые внесенные записи для формирования накладной?
...
Рейтинг: 0 / 0
25 сообщений из 48, страница 1 из 2
Форумы / Microsoft Access [игнор отключен] [закрыт для гостей] / Форма
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]